Subaru NZ to add all-new Trailseeker electric SUV
The Subaru Trailseeker has a driving range of up to 488 kilometres. Photos: Subaru NZ
Subaru New Zealand is excited to confirm the all-new, all-electric Trailseeker will join the New Zealand SUV line-up in September 2026.
An entirely new nameplate for the brand, Trailseeker is Subaru’s first electric SUV option in New Zealand.
Producing 280 kW of maximum combined power and accelerating from 0–100 km/h in approximately 4.4 seconds, Trailseeker is set to become the fastest-accelerating production Subaru ever built.
What’s more, it delivers these performance credentials without losing the all-road capability that makes Subaru so well-suited to New Zealand’s varied conditions.

With 211mm of ground clearance, Symmetrical All-Wheel Drive and low centre of gravity, Trailseeker brings genuine all-terrain confidence, wrapped in a dynamic, purposeful and exciting SUV design.
The Trailseeker has Subaru’s next-generation e-Subaru Global Platform, developed specifically to support higher outputs, extended driving range and enhanced all-wheel drive performance.
The rigid architecture intelligently manages power delivery, traction and vehicle balance in real time, creating a driving experience defined by composure, assurance and control across sealed roads, rough surfaces and longer-distance journeys.
Power is supplied by a 74.7 kWh CATL battery, delivering a driving range of up to 488 kilometres.

With 150 kW DC fast-charging, Trailseeker can charge from 10 to 80 per cent in approximately 30 minutes, while 22 kW three-phase AC charging and 1500 W Vehicle-to-Load (V2L) capability further supports versatility and everyday usability alongside its performance credentials.
With a 1,500kg braked towing capacity, Trailseeker reinforces its role as an electric SUV designed for real-world adventure and everyday practicality.
